Buffer overflow in Cisco Systems, Inc products - CVE-2020-3453

Published: September 3, 2020


Vulnerability identifier: #VU46258
CSH Severity: Low
CVSS v4: 8.6 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:H/UI:N/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N]
CVE-ID: CVE-2020-3453
CWE-ID: CWE-119
Exploitation vector: Remote access
Exploit availability: No public exploit available

Vulnerability details

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.

The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error in the web-based management interface. A remote administrator can send a specially crafted request, trigger memory corruption and execute arbitrary code on the target system.

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.


Affected software

Cisco RV340W Dual WAN Gigabit Wireless-AC VPN Router
Cisco RV340 Dual WAN Gigabit VPN Router
Cisco RV345 Dual WAN Gigabit VPN Router
Cisco RV345P Dual WAN Gigabit VPN Router

How to mitigate CVE-2020-3453

Install updates from vendor's website.

Cisco RV340W Dual WAN Gigabit Wireless-AC VPN Router - update to 1.0.03.19
Cisco RV340 Dual WAN Gigabit VPN Router - update to 1.0.03.19
Cisco RV345 Dual WAN Gigabit VPN Router - update to 1.0.03.19
Cisco RV345P Dual WAN Gigabit VPN Router - update to 1.0.03.19
